Discover top West Ireland attractions with your pet

West Ireland offers a remarkable blend of breathtaking landscapes and pet-friendly activities, making it a perfect getaway for travellers with furry companions. Start your adventure at the stunning Cliffs of Moher, where you and your pet can enjoy invigorating walks along the coastal paths, soaking in the dramatic ocean views and the fresh sea breeze. Next, head to the picturesque Connemara National Park, where the expansive trails invite exploration; your dog will love the freedom of running through the rugged terrain and discovering the local wildlife. A visit to the charming town of Doolin is essential, where you can unwind at dog-friendly cafes and enjoy live traditional music, ensuring both you and your pet feel welcome. The vibrant town of Galway is another highlight, with its colourful streets and pet-friendly parks, perfect for leisurely strolls. Finally, don't miss the opportunity to explore the enchanting Aran Islands, where you can take a ferry ride with your pet and wander through ancient ruins and stunning landscapes. For a comfortable stay, consider the pet-friendly accommodations in the coastal region of Clare, where many hotels offer convenient amenities for pets, making your trip both relaxing and enjoyable.
